For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 368 students in 43906, OH.
The top-ranked public middle school in 43906, OH is Bellaire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 43906 have an average math proficiency score of 79% (versus the Ohio public middle school average of 50%), and reading proficiency score of 58% (versus the 55% statewide average). Middle schools in 43906, OH have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Ohio public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Ohio public middle school average of 39% (majority Black).
